The difference between a first aid kit and a trauma kit is the difference between treating a paper cut and treating a life-threatening injury. Most commercial first aid kits are designed for minor injuries in settings where 911 response arrives in minutes. Emergency preparedness requires planning for scenarios where help is 30 minutes away — or longer. The STOP THE BLEED campaign, backed by the American College of Surgeons and the Department of Homeland Security, identifies uncontrolled external hemorrhage as the leading preventable cause of death in trauma scenarios. An emergency radio is one of the most overlooked pieces of preparedness gear — until you need it. When the grid goes down and cell networks are overloaded or offline, a hand crank emergency radio with NOAA weather alert reception is the most reliable way to receive official emergency information and broadcasts. FEMA’s emergency preparedness guidelines specifically list a battery-powered or hand crank NOAA weather radio as an essential item in every household emergency kit. Why a Multi-Tool is Essential Survival Gear A quality multi-tool is one of the highest-value items in any emergency kit. Where a knife handles cutting tasks, a multi-tool handles the mechanical problems that emerge in every real emergency: tightening a loose screw on a generator, cutting wire to improvise a shelter, opening canned food without a can opener, splinting an injury with pliers and wire, and a hundred other tasks that a single blade can’t address. ...

Why Solar Power Is Critical for Emergency Preparedness When a major storm, ice event, or infrastructure failure takes down the power grid, rechargeable devices become as limited as their battery. Phones, emergency radios, flashlights, CPAP machines, and communication devices all eventually go dark. Solar power changes that equation: as long as the sun rises, you have access to electricity. Ready.gov’s power outage preparedness guidance increasingly emphasizes alternative power sources as grid outages grow longer and more frequent. NOAA hurricane data shows that major storm events routinely knock out power for 1–4 weeks in affected areas — far beyond the capacity of any fixed battery bank. ...

Why Your Flashlight Choice Matters in Emergencies When the power goes out — whether from a hurricane, ice storm, earthquake, or grid failure — a flashlight becomes one of your most critical tools. Not a candle, not your phone screen: a dedicated, purpose-built flashlight. FEMA’s emergency kit guidelines list a flashlight as a core item in every emergency supply kit, and for good reason. In a grid-down scenario, your flashlight performs multiple functions: navigating your home safely, reading emergency instructions, signaling for rescue, deterring threats, and performing medical tasks in the dark.
